    Abstract: A system, non-transitory computer readable medium, and method include entering redundant oscillators and a cascaded oscillator of a spoofing resistant system into an initialization state. All but one of the redundant oscillators are disciplined to a time-and-frequency external input into normal disciplining state with the remaining one of the redundant oscillators in a holdover state. When all but one of the redundant oscillators have reached the normal disciplining state, placing all but one of the redundant oscillators into the holdover state, disciplining the remaining one of the redundant oscillators to the time and frequency external input, and disciplining the cascaded oscillator to one of the all but one of the redundant oscillators now in the holdover state. When the remaining one of the redundant oscillators and the cascaded oscillator have reached the normal disciplining state, transitioning from an initialization stage to a steady state management stage.

    Abstract: A method, GNSS simulator, and non-transitory computer readable medium for providing a simulated global navigation satellite system (GNSS) signal. The method includes receiving, by a GNSS simulator, a precision timing signal and one or more items of ephemeris data from a GNSS receiver based on a decoded GNSS signal received by the GNSS receiver. The precision timing signal and the one or more items of GNSS ephemeris data are received in a digital format over a communication network. A simulated GNSS signal is generated, by the GNSS simulator, based on the received precision timing signal and one or more items of ephemeris data. The simulated GNSS signal is transmitted, by the GNSS simulator, over a coverage area. A GNSS system for providing a simulated GNSS signal is also disclosed.

    Abstract: A method, non-transitory computer readable medium, and apparatus that determines a GPS location includes obtaining assisted GPS data of locations of a plurality of GPS satellites, current time, and initial location data of the receiver computing device. A GPS signal from one or more of the plurality of GPS satellites within a frequency range and time range is acquired based on the obtained assisted GPS data, current time, and initial location data of the receiver computing device. The one or more acquired GPS signals are integrated over a frame period of two or more seconds. A GPS location for the receiver computing device is determined based on the one or more integrated GPS signals.
